Paris, May 23rd 2018 Alvimedica Medical Technologies, a leading European company in interventional cardiology and innovative stent and catheter producer, officially unveiled today the details of the Diab8 study, the first diabetic Drug-Eluting Stent (DES) randomized trial, during the Annual Meeting of EuroPCR 2018, the World-Leading Course in interventional cardiovascular medicine in Paris, France, May 22-25 2018.
 
Diab8 is the first diabetic DES study (a 55-center, 3,040-patient randomized controlled trial) that pits the performance of Cre8™ EVO, a Polymer-free Amphilimus-eluting stent, against the Everolimus-Eluting stents in the treatment of coronary artery disease in diabetic patients, in order to prove its superior efficacy at 1 year.
 
Today, diabetes is a major contributor to cardiovascular diseases and is the eleventh common cause of disability worldwide. According to data from the Diabetes Atlas 2017 of the International Diabetes Federation, half a billion people live with diabetes1 and the number may rise up to 629 million in 2045. The increased incidence of this disease is mainly due to rising levels of overweight, obesity, physical inactivity and poor diet. The South-East Asia and Western Pacific regions are at the epicenter of the diabetes crisis: China alone has 121 million people with diabetes and India’s diabetes population totals 74 million. Europe follows with its 85 million people suffering from diabetes.
 
Furthermore, almost half of the people with diabetes are undiagnosed worldwide and this is the reason why it has become urgent to tackle this issue through appropriate screening, diagnosis and cares.
 
People with diabetes have an increased risk of developing cardiovascular complications such as angina, coronary artery diseases, myocardial infarction and acute coronary syndrome. The new stent is designed to provide a controlled elution of the Amphilimus™ formulation through the Abluminal Reservoir Technology, a proprietary polymer-free drug-release system consisting of reservoirs on the stent’s outer surface that control and direct drug release exclusively towards the vessel wall, including complex coronary anatomies and pathologies like those of diabetics.
The Amphilimus™ formulation, a proprietary Sirolimus and Fatty Acids mix, enables enhanced drug tissue permeation and maximize drug bioavailability, utilizing fatty acid transport pathways. This is particularly advantageous in diabetic patients since increased uptake of fatty acid occurs in diabetic cells, increasing device efficacy2.

Cre8™ EVO is designed to provide a controlled elution of the Amphilimus™ formulation (a combination of sirolimus and fatty acid) through its Abluminal Reservoir Technology. The new stent architecture, together with the ground breaking Cre8™ EVO proprietary technology, has been conceived to guarantee effective drug concentration within the vessel wall including complex coronary anatomies and pathologies like those of diabetic patients. The very thin cobalt chromium body, sealed by the Bio Inducer Surface, provides high haemo- and bio-compatibility increasing the rate of strut coverage and thus potentially reducing thrombogenicity.
